There's an Antiques Roadshow special, "Priceless Antiques Roadshow" on on Mondays at 6.30 pm.

In the first one, this coming Monday, (1/2/10), Andy is taught and supervised by the master glassmaker, Tim Harris, at Isle of Wight Studio Glass as he has a go at glassmaking.
